The movie will also include an original song co-written by Gunn and score composer Tyler Bates, with a pretty interesting performer attached. "I've always been into Hindu creation myths and there's some similarities there." "There's this big creation myth about how he came about and it was kind of lined up with that," Gunn said. George Harrison's "My Sweet Lord" (one of the first songs Gunn picked out for the film) will provide some information about Peter's father Ego the Living Planet. Sam Cooke's "Bring it on Home to Me" will serve as a symbol of Peter and Gamora's relationship and Jay and the Americans' "Come a Little Bit Closer" scoring an ultra-violent and "really fun" action scene. "Brandy" will show up in the first scene of the film, with Gunn saying that the song (used to score an emotional moment) is one he's "sort of sadly, tragically related to." "The Chain," he said, will pop up a couple times in the movie, with the song being used to tell us something about the Guardians. Gunn said there are two other songs that are "deeply embedded into the fibers" of the film: "The Chain" by Fleetwood Mac and "Brandy You're a Fine Girl" by Looking Glass. "It's really joyous, but there's a really dark underpinning to it." "It's the perfect song to start the movie," he said, adding that, if the Guardians had a house band, it would be ELO.
